Do the Driving Modes in Cadillac LYRIQ Offer Different Ranges?
If you’re shopping for a Cadillac LYRIQ or already own one, you’ve probably wondered whether changing the drive mode affects how far you can travel on a charge.
The short answer is yes—but indirectly.
The vehicle’s battery doesn’t become larger or smaller when you switch modes. Instead, each driving mode changes how the electric motors deliver power and how efficiently that stored energy is used. That means your real-world range can improve or decrease depending on the selected mode, your driving habits, road conditions, and weather. Cadillac LYRIQ General Motors
Quick Overview
| Driving Mode | Main Purpose | Typical Effect on Battery Use |
|---|---|---|
| Tour | Everyday driving and efficiency | Usually the most energy-efficient |
| Sport | Faster acceleration and sharper response | Can increase energy consumption |
| Snow/Ice | Better traction on slippery roads | May reduce efficiency slightly due to traction management |
| My Mode | Driver customization | Depends on the settings you choose |
The actual difference depends far more on how you drive than simply which mode is selected.
How Driving Modes Affect Battery Usage
The LYRIQ uses software to change how the vehicle responds to driver inputs.
Instead of changing battery capacity, each mode adjusts several vehicle systems.
Throttle Response
Sport Mode makes the accelerator pedal more responsive.
That encourages quicker acceleration, which draws more power from the battery. Frequent hard acceleration typically uses more electricity than smooth acceleration.
Tour Mode softens throttle response, making it easier to accelerate gradually and conserve energy.
Regenerative Braking
Electric vehicles recover energy when slowing down.
Driving modes can influence how regenerative braking feels, although one-pedal driving settings also play an important role.
In stop-and-go traffic, efficient regenerative braking helps recover some of the energy that would otherwise be lost as heat.
Power Delivery
The electric motors can deliver enormous torque instantly.
Sport Mode prioritizes performance.
Tour Mode prioritizes smoother power delivery.
Snow/Ice Mode carefully limits torque to reduce wheel slip on slippery roads.
Does Tour Mode Provide the Best Range?
For most drivers, yes.
Tour Mode is designed for everyday driving and generally encourages efficient acceleration and smoother power delivery.
That doesn’t mean the vehicle magically gains extra battery capacity. Instead, drivers often consume less energy because the vehicle discourages aggressive inputs.
Tour Mode works especially well for:
- Daily commuting
- Highway cruising
- Long-distance travel
- Moderate weather
- Predictable traffic conditions
Does Sport Mode Reduce Driving Range?
Usually, yes.
Sport Mode itself isn’t inefficient.
Instead, it encourages behavior that naturally requires more electricity.
Examples include:
- Faster acceleration
- Higher average speeds
- More frequent passing
- Stronger motor output
At steady highway speeds with gentle acceleration, the difference between Tour and Sport may be relatively small.
During spirited city driving, however, energy consumption can increase noticeably.
What About Snow/Ice Mode?
Snow/Ice Mode is designed for safety rather than efficiency.
It modifies torque delivery and traction control so the tires maintain grip on slippery roads.
Although this may slightly affect energy consumption, the larger benefit is improved vehicle stability during rain, snow, or icy conditions.
Choosing Snow/Ice Mode simply to save battery isn’t recommended unless road conditions require it.
How Does My Mode Affect Battery Usage?
My Mode allows drivers to personalize certain vehicle characteristics.
Depending on the available settings, you may customize items such as steering feel or acceleration response.
If your custom profile mimics Tour Mode, efficiency may remain similar.
If it behaves more like Sport Mode, energy usage may increase.
Which Factors Affect Range More Than Driving Modes?
Many owners focus on drive modes, but several other factors usually have a much larger effect on battery usage.
Speed
Highway speeds above approximately 70 mph significantly increase aerodynamic drag.
This is often one of the biggest reasons EV range drops during long road trips.
Outside Temperature
Cold weather reduces battery efficiency and increases cabin heating demands.
Hot weather may also reduce efficiency because the air conditioner and battery cooling system require additional energy.
Driving Style
Smooth acceleration and anticipating stops generally improve efficiency far more than simply selecting Tour Mode.
Tire Pressure
Properly inflated tires reduce rolling resistance.
Underinflated tires can noticeably reduce efficiency over time.
Wheel Size
Larger wheels often look great but may slightly reduce overall efficiency compared with smaller wheel options due to increased weight and rolling resistance.

Does the EPA Publish Different Range Ratings for Each Mode?
No.
Official EPA driving range estimates are based on standardized testing procedures and vehicle configuration—not individual drive modes.
You’ll see different EPA ratings based on factors such as:
- Rear-wheel drive vs. all-wheel drive
- Wheel size
- Vehicle trim
- Performance variants
The selected driving mode isn’t assigned its own official EPA range figure.

Common Misconceptions
“Sport Mode permanently damages battery life.”
No.
Using Sport Mode occasionally is part of the vehicle’s intended design.
The battery management system protects the battery during normal operation.
“Tour Mode always gives exactly the same range.”
Not necessarily.
Traffic, weather, elevation, speed, and driving habits still influence battery usage.
“Changing modes changes battery capacity.”
No.
The battery stores the same amount of energy regardless of the selected driving mode.
Only the way that energy is delivered changes.
